The State of Connecticut, new Veterans’ Health Center in Rocky Hill, CT, is completed.  The Dedication and Ribbon cutting took place on Thursday, May 22, 2008. 

As you may know, the Labor Department would not allow us into the project, until the hospital was completed, and that’s another story.  But, now that the hospital is complete, we can move forward.  

Because the Connecticut Spa & Pool Association (CONSPA) believes in warm water therapy, to help our heroes recuperate, the following is a description of the two (2) pools that will be constructed.  

1. Therapeutic Pool:
The 15’ x 30’ therapeutic pool contains a 7’x7’ spa and other therapeutic water features with specialized handicap equipment to make it easier to get in and out of the water.  

2.  Exercise/Recreational Pool:
Adjacent to the therapeutic pool will be an exercise/recreational pool, 30’ x 50’ with wheelchair accessible ramp and lifts, to make it easy to get in and out of the water.   Numerous exercise bars and other therapeutic equipment will be installed on both pools. Both pools will be heated for warm water therapy and relaxation, and fully equipped with the latest filter plants. These pools will provide the veterans with the opportunity to get hydrotherapy and recreation, without having to leave the hospital. Incidentally, the Rocky Hill Veterans’ Home & Hospital is a state run hospital.  The other two (2) Veterans’ Hospitals in Connecticut (Newington and New Haven), are federal hospitals.  The Rocky Hill pools also will benefit patients in Newington and New Haven, who will be transported by bus to use the facilities, several times a day.  Further, these pools are open to all vets (past, present and future).  The important factor is that we hope to be able to start the project by September 2008 and finish by Spring 2009, the best time for us to build.

Examination of Plans and Specifications for a Proposed
Public Whirlpool Spa To Be Located at the Veteran’s Home

 
SUBJECT: ROCKY HILL, CT.; Examination of Plans and Specifications for a Proposed Public Whirlpool Spa To Be Located at the Veteran’s Home

TO: Connecticut Department of Public Health

FROM: Century Pools, Incorporated
Consulting Division

LOCATION: 287 West Street

ENGINEER: ***

POOL CONSTRUCTION FIRM: Rizzo Pool; 3388 Berlin Turnpike; Newington, CT 06111

APPLICANT: Charley Williams HMCM (SS) USN RET, Chief of Staff; Connecticut Department of Veteran’s Affairs; 287 West Street; Rocky Hill, CT

PROPOSED CONSTRUCTION: Outdoor Whirlpool Spa; Rectangular In Shape; To Be Constructed Of Steel Reinforced Pneumatically Placed Concrete; To Be Provided With Cartridge Filtration and Automatic Chlorination Equipment

WATER SUPPLY: Metropolitan District Commission

PLAN DIMENSIONS AND CAPACITY: 8.5 Ft. X 7 Ft.; 59.5 Ft.2; 900 Gallons

MAXIMUM WATER DEPTH: 36 Inches Maximum Water Depth

MAXIMUM DEPTH ABOVE SEATS: 18 Inches

MINIMUM HEIGHT OF CEILING ABOVE POOL RIM: N/A (Outdoor Whirlpool Spa)

RECIRCULATING INLETS: (2) HAYWARD #SP-1419D Cycolac Directional Wall Inlets; 1½ Inch  Pipes

OUTLET/MAIN DRAIN: (1) HAYWARD #SP-1052AV; 8 Inch Diameter Antivortex Main Drain; 2 Inch  Pipe

SKIMMER: (1) HAYWARD #SP-1082 Surface Skimmer; 2 Inch  Pipe

HYDROJET SYSTEM:
A.) HYDROJET PUMP: (1) HAYWARD #SP-3015; 1½ H.P.; Rated At 120 G.P.M. At 30 Ft. T.D.H.
B.) HYDROJET INLETS: (4) HAYWARD #SP-1430 Hydrojet Inlets
C.) SUCTION FITTINGS: (2) HAYWARD #SP-1054AV Side Wall Antivortex Fittings

AIR BLOWER: None

SUCTION CLEANER: (1) RAINBOW LIFEGARD #250; 19 Inch Vacuum Head With 50 Ft. Hose and 16 Ft. Telescoping Pole

CIRCULATING PUMP: (1) HAYWARD #SP-3007; ¾ H.P.; Rated at 55 G.P.M. at 60 Feet T.D.H.; Single Phase

TIME FOR POOL TURNOVER: 900 Gallons = 16.4 Minutes
55 G.P.M.

FLOW GAUGE: (1) SIGNET #MK 5090 Flowmeter with #MK 515 Paddlewheel Flosensor and #150PV8S015 Pipe Saddle - 2 Inch  Pipe; Scale 0 G.P.M. to 200 G.P.M.

HAIR CATCHER: Integral Part of Pump

FILTERS: (2) STA-RITE #PTM100 Cartridge Filters; N.S.F. Listed

FILTER AREA: 100 Ft.2/ Filter x 2 Filters = 200 Ft.2 Total Filter Area

FILTRATION RATE: 0.275 G.P.M./Ft.2 of Filter Area When Operating at 55 G.P.M.

SIGHT GLASS: None (Cartridge Filter)

MAKE-UP WATER/PLACE OF INTRODUCTION: Via a ¾ Inch Over-The-Rim Fillspout Located Beneath a Handrail and Air Gapped 3 Inches Minimum Above the Spa Rim

CHLORINATOR: (1) ROLACHEM #RC-25/50; Capacity 9.6 G.P.D.

CHEMICAL FEED: (1) LINK AUTOMATION, INC. PoolLink #200 Carbon Dioxide Feed System

AUTOMATIC CONTROLLER: (1) LINK AUTOMATION, INC. PoolLink #1300 with 5101 Probe Chamber and RFO Flow Sensor

TESTING EQUIPMENT: (1) TAYLOR #K-2005 DPD Test Kit

UNDERWATER LIGHT: (1) HAYWARD #SP0580; 100 Watt, 12 Volt Underwater Light

SHOWERS & TOILETS:
1) MALE: * Toilets, * Urinals, * Lavatory Sinks, * Showers
2) FEMALE: * Toilets, * Lavatory Sinks, * Showers

BATHER ROUTING & FENCING: *** Fence * Feet Height Completely Around Pool Area; Entry Gates to be Self-Closing, Self-Latching, and Lockable

DECK & DECK DRAINS: Concrete Deck 5 Feet Minimum Width Around 50% of Spa Perimeter

TOILET & SHOWER WASTE DISPOSAL: To Sanitary Sewer

FILTER BACKWASH WATER DISPOSAL: N/A (Cartridge Filter)

DRY WELL SIZE & CAPACITY: N/A

POOL DRAINAGE: To Sanitary Sewer Via a 6 Inch Minimum Air Gap


Examination of Plans and Specifications for a Proposed Public
Swimming Pool To Be Located at the Veteran’s Home

SUBJECT: ROCKY HILL, CT.; Examination of Plans and Specifications for a Proposed Public Swimming Pool To Be Located at the Veteran’s Home

TO: Connecticut Department of Public Health

FROM: Century Pools, Incorporated
Consulting Division

LOCATION: 287 West Street

ENGINEER: ***

POOL CONSTRUCTION FIRM: Rizzo Pool; 3388 Berlin Turnpike; Newington, CT 06111

APPLICANT: Charley Williams HMCM (SS) USN RET, Chief of Staff; Connecticut Department of Veteran’s Affairs; 287 West Street; Rocky Hill, CT

PROPOSED CONSTRUCTION: Outdoor Swimming Pool; Rectangular In Shape; To Be Constructed Of Steel Reinforced Pneumatically Placed Concrete; To Be Provided With High Rate Sand Filtration and Automatic Chlorination Equipment

WATER SUPPLY: Metropolitan District Commission

RECOMMENDED MAXIMUM BATHING LOAD: 1,250 Ft.2 = 50 Bathers
25 Ft.2

PLAN DIMENSIONS AND CAPACITY: 50 Ft. Maximum Length X 30 Ft.; 1,500 Ft.2; 50,000 Gallons

SLOPE OF BOTTOM IN SHALLOW AREA: 3.5 Feet to 5 Feet Water Depth in 30 Feet Linear = 1:20 (Uniform Slope 3.5 Feet to 5.5 Feet Water Depth)

SLOPE OF BOTTOM 5 FEET TO MAXIMUM DEPTH: 5 Feet to 5.5 Feet Water Depth in 10 Feet Linear = 1:20 (Uniform Slope 3.5 Feet to 5.5 Feet Water Depth)

VERTICAL WALLS (Deep End): Vertical For 4 Feet Below Water Level; Then Curved to the Bottom With a 1.5 Ft. Radius

DIVING BOARD: None

EFFECTIVE DEPTH AT DIVING AREA: N/A

MINIMUM HEIGHT OF CEILING ABOVE DIVING BOARD: N/A

RECIRCULATING INLETS: (6) HAYWARD #SP-1419D Cycolac Directional Wall Inlets; 3 Inch  Pipe to 1½ Inch  Pipes

OUTLETS/MAIN DRAINS: (2) HAYWARD #SP-1051; 8 Inch Diameter Main Drains; 14 In.2 Open Area Per Grate; 1½ Inch  Pipes to 3 Inch  Pipe

SKIMMERS/OVERFLOW: (4) HAYWARD #SP-1082-1 Surface Skimmers; 1½ Inch  Pipes to 4 Inch  Pipe

SUCTION CLEANER: (1) RAINBOW LIFEGARD #250; 19 Inch Vacuum Head With 50 Ft. Hose and 16 Ft. Telescoping Pole

CIRCULATING PUMP: (1) HAYWARD #SP-3025; 3 H.P.; Rated at 149 G.P.M. at 50 Feet T.D.H.

TIME FOR POOL TURNOVER: 50,000 Gallons = 5.59 Hours
149 G.P.M. X 60 Min./Hour

FLOW GAUGE: (1) SIGNET #MK 5090 Flowmeter with #MK 515 Paddlewheel Flosensor and #150PV8S030 Pipe Saddle - 3 Inch  Pipe; Scale 0 G.P.M. to 400 G.P.M.

HAIR CATCHER: Integral Part of Pump

FILTERS: (2) PENTAIR TRITON II COMMERCIAL #TR-100C; 30 Inch Diameter High Rate Sand Filters; N.S.F. Listed

FILTER AREA: 4.91 Ft.2/ Filter x 2 Filters = 9.82 Ft.2 Total Filter Area

FILTRATION RATE: 15.17 G.P.M./Ft.2 of Filter Area When Operating at 149 G.P.M.

BALANCE/SURGE TANK: None

SIGHT GLASS: (1) S.R. SMITH #A-41198-0

MAKE-UP WATER/PLACE OF INTRODUCTION: Via a ¾ Inch Over-The-Rim Fillspout Located Adjacent to a Ladder and Air Gapped 3 Inches Minimum Above the Pool Rim

CHLORINATOR: (1) (1) ROLACHEM #RC-100; Capacity 40 G.P.D.

CHEMICAL FEED: (1) LINK AUTOMATION, INC. PoolLink #200 Carbon Dioxide Feed System

AUTOMATIC CONTROLLER: (1) LINK AUTOMATION, INC. PoolLink #1300 with 5101 Probe Chamber and RFO Flow Sensor

TESTING EQUIPMENT: (1) TAYLOR #K-2005 DPD Test Kit

UNDERWATER LIGHTS: (2) HAYWARD #SP0583; 500 Watt, 120 Volt Underwater Lights

SHOWERS & TOILETS:
1) MALE: * Toilets, * Urinals, * Lavatory Sinks, * Showers
2) FEMALE: * Toilets, * Lavatory Sinks, * Showers

BATHER ROUTING & FENCING: *** Fence * Feet Height Completely Around Pool Area; Entry Gates to be Self-Closing, Self-Latching, and Lockable

DECK & DECK DRAINS: Concrete Deck * Feet Minimum Width Completely Around Swimming Pool Perimeter

TOILET & SHOWER WASTE DISPOSAL: To Sanitary Sewer

FILTER BACKWASH WATER DISPOSAL: To Sanitary Sewer Via 6 Inch Minimum Air Gap

DRY WELL SIZE & CAPACITY: N/A

POOL DRAINAGE: To Sanitary Sewer Via 6 Inch Minimum Air Gap


Examination of Plans and Specifications for a Proposed Special Purpose
Therapeutic Pool To Be Located at the Veteran’s Home


SUBJECT: ROCKY HILL, CT.; Examination of Plans and Specifications for a Proposed Special Purpose Therapeutic Pool To Be Located at the Veteran’s Home

TO: Connecticut Department of Public Health

FROM: Century Pools, Incorporated
Consulting Division

LOCATION: 287 West Street

ENGINEER: ***

POOL CONSTRUCTION FIRM: Rizzo Pool; 3388 Berlin Turnpike; Newington, CT 06111

APPLICANT: Charley Williams HMCM (SS) USN RET, Chief of Staff; Connecticut Department of Veteran’s Affairs; 287 West Street; Rocky Hill, CT

PROPOSED CONSTRUCTION: Outdoor Special Purpose Therapeutic Pool; Modified Rectangular Shape; To Be Constructed Of Steel Reinforced Pneumatically Placed Concrete; To Be Provided With High Rate Sand Filtration and Automatic Chlorination Equipment

WATER SUPPLY: Metropolitan District Commission

RECOMMENDED MAXIMUM BATHING LOAD: 374 Ft.2 = 15 Bathers
25 Ft.2

PLAN DIMENSIONS AND CAPACITY: 30 Ft. Maximum Length X 15 Ft. Maximum Width; 374 Ft.2; 12,500 Gallons

SLOPE OF BOTTOM IN SHALLOW AREA: 3.5 Feet to 5 Feet Water Depth in 18 Feet Linear = 1:12

SLOPE OF BOTTOM 5 FEET TO MAXIMUM DEPTH: N/A; 5 Feet Maximum Water Depth

VERTICAL WALLS (Deep End): Vertical For 3 Feet Below Water Level; Then Curved to the Bottom With a 2 Ft. Radius

DIVING BOARD: None

EFFECTIVE DEPTH AT DIVING AREA: N/A

MINIMUM HEIGHT OF CEILING ABOVE DIVING BOARD: N/A

RECIRCULATING INLETS: (3) HAYWARD #SP-1419D Cycolac Directional Wall Inlets; 2 Inch  Pipe to 1½ Inch  Pipes

OUTLETS/MAIN DRAINS: (2) HAYWARD #SP-1051; 8 Inch Diameter Main Drains; 14 In.2 Open Area Per Grate; 1½ Inch  Pipes

SKIMMERS/OVERFLOW: (2) HAYWARD #SP-1082-1 Surface Skimmers; Separate 1½ Inch  Pipes

SUCTION CLEANER: (1) RAINBOW LIFEGARD #250; 19 Inch Vacuum Head With 50 Ft. Hose and 16 Ft. Telescoping Pole

CIRCULATING PUMP: (1) HAYWARD #SP-3007; ¾ H.P.; Rated at 68 G.P.M. at 50 Feet T.D.H.; Single Phase

TIME FOR POOL TURNOVER: 12,500 Gallons = 3.06 Hours
68 G.P.M. X 60 Min./Hour

FLOW GAUGE: (1) SIGNET #MK 5090 Flowmeter with #MK 515 Paddlewheel Flosensor and #150PV8S020 Pipe Saddle - 2 Inch  Pipe; Scale 0 G.P.M. to 200 G.P.M.

HAIR CATCHER: Integral Part of Pump

FILTERS: (1) PENTAIR TRITON II COMMERCIAL #TR-100C; 30 Inch Diameter High Rate Sand Filter; N.S.F. Listed

FILTER AREA: 4.91 Ft.2

FILTRATION RATE: 13.85 G.P.M./Ft.2 of Filter Area When Operating at 68 G.P.M.

BALANCE/SURGE TANK: None

SIGHT GLASS: (1) HAYWARD #SP-1074

MAKE-UP WATER/PLACE OF INTRODUCTION: Via a ¾ Inch Over-The-Rim Fillspout Located Adjacent to the Ladder and Air Gapped 3 Inches Minimum Above the Pool Rim

CHLORINATOR: (1) ROLACHEM #RC-25/50; Capacity 9.6 G.P.D.

CHEMICAL FEED: (1) LINK AUTOMATION, INC. PoolLink #200 Carbon Dioxide Feed System

AUTOMATIC CONTROLLER: (1) LINK AUTOMATION, INC. PoolLink #1300 with 5101 Probe Chamber and RFO Flow Sensor

TESTING EQUIPMENT: (1) TAYLOR #K-2005 DPD Test Kit

UNDERWATER LIGHTS: (1) HAYWARD #SP0581; 300 Watt; 12 Volt Underwater Light

SHOWERS & TOILETS:
1) MALE: * Toilets, * Urinals, * Lavatory Sinks, * Showers
2) FEMALE: * Toilets, * Lavatory Sinks, * Showers

BATHER ROUTING & FENCING: *** Fence * Feet Height Completely Around Pool Area; Entry Gates to be Self-Closing, Self-Latching, and Lockable

DECK & DECK DRAINS: Concrete Deck * Feet Minimum Width Completely Around Therapeutic Pool Perimeter

TOILET & SHOWER WASTE DISPOSAL: To Sanitary Sewer

FILTER BACKWASH WATER DISPOSAL: To Sanitary Sewer Via 6 Inch Minimum Air Gap

DRY WELL SIZE & CAPACITY: N/A

POOL DRAINAGE: To Sanitary Sewer Via 6 Inch Minimum Air Gap
